According to Pasco Fire officials, the blaze that consumed a home at 1753 North 22nd continues to be investigated, but it’s mysterious that it “rekindled” according to fire officials. The new blaze started late Thursday night.
Earlier in the day, the fire was reported at the home, three people were able to get out, and are now being helped by the Red Cross. Benjamin Shearer of the Pasco Fire Department says the scene was secured by crews, and they left for the night.
